While on assignment in Hong Kong last month I took the opportunity to pick up the new Nikon D810, and a Nikon PC-E 24mm f/3.5 lens. The lens allows you to tilt and shift to help keep perspective correct and increase potential depth of field. I took it down to the very centre of London last night to test it out…
